FAQ about EDMISTON YACHT MANAGEMENT LTD company
What is EDMISTON YACHT MANAGEMENT LTD?
EDMISTON YACHT MANAGEMENT LTD is ISM Manager and Commercial manager and based in Monaco.
How many vessels does EDMISTON YACHT MANAGEMENT LTD manage?
The EDMISTON YACHT MANAGEMENT LTD manages a fleet of 24 vessels.
What is the total deadweight tonnage (DWT) of the EDMISTON YACHT MANAGEMENT LTD's fleet?
The total DWT of the EDMISTON YACHT MANAGEMENT LTD's fleet is 4,766 metric tons.
What types of vessels are in the EDMISTON YACHT MANAGEMENT LTD's fleet?
The fleet consists primarily of Pleasure craft (95.83%).
What is the age distribution EDMISTON YACHT MANAGEMENT LTD's fleet?
The vessels are distributed by age as follows: 0-5 years (8.33%), 6-10 years (25%), 11-15 years (12.5%) and 15+ years (54.17%).
